Abstract

The invention discloses a kind of medical treatment bone medicinal material processing systems, including outer housing, front and back is provided through processing of crude drugs chamber in the outer housing, lower pushing device is provided in the processing of crude drugs chamber top end wall, loading chute is provided in the end wall of the processing of crude drugs bottom of chamber, medicinal material Article holding box is detachably provided in the loading chute, the medicinal material that opening upwards are provided in the medicinal material Article holding box contains chamber, it is provided with the first automatically controlled sucker in the loading chute base end wall, the left sliding groove and right sliding groove extended downwardly is symmetrically arranged in the wall of processing of crude drugs chamber left and right ends;Apparatus of the present invention overall structure is simple, design safety is reasonable, it can be realized automatic control and processing carried out to medicinal material, effectively increase the working efficiency of medicinal material processing, and the present apparatus combines the function of chopping and the stirring of medicinal material in one, greatly reduce production cost, and the procedure of processing that medicinal material will have been lacked.

When original state, the press disk 53 is contracted in the disk cavity 50, and the movable block 61 is located at described The centre of shifting chute 60, the chopping component are contracted in the left sliding groove 3, and the left sliding shoe 30 is located at the left sliding The left end position of slot 3, the left elevator 32 are pressed and position upwards under the resilient force of the left top pressure spring 35 In the topmost position of the left lifting groove 31,22 top end face of medicinal material Article holding box is lower than first left rotation shaft 37 at this time Bottom end, the mixing component are contracted in the right sliding groove 4, and the right sliding shoe 40 is located at the most right of the right sliding groove 4 End position, the right elevator 42 are pressed upwards under the resilient force of the right top pressure spring 45 and are located at the right liter The topmost position of slot 41 drops, and 22 top end face of medicinal material Article holding box is lower than 47 bottom end of the first right rotation shafts at this time.
When needing to carry out medicinal material chopping processing, first the medicinal material of the treatment bone by acquisition back is put into the medicinal material and is contained Medicinal material in vanning 22 contains in chamber 23, controls second motor 63 later and works, the 63 task driven institute of the second motor The left end position that movable block 61 slides into the shifting chute 60 to the left is stated, at this time the drive bevel gear 65 and the left cone tooth 66 engagement of wheel, controls the first motor 64 and works, later 65 turns of drive bevel gear described in 64 task driven of first motor Dynamic, the rotation of left angular wheel 66 described in 65 rotate driving of drive bevel gear, the rotation of left angular wheel 66 drives the left spiral shell Rasp bar 67 rotates, and left sliding shoe 30 described in 67 rotate driving of left-hand thread bar slides to the right, and the left sliding shoe 30 is slided to the right It is dynamic that the left elevator 32 is driven to slide to the right and be inserted into the processing of crude drugs chamber 2, until the left sliding shoe 30 to the right The right end position of the left sliding groove 3 is slided into, the cutter 38 are located at the top that the medicinal material contains chamber 23 at this time, connect The control hydraulic cylinder 51 work, hydraulic telescopic rod 52 described in 51 task driven of hydraulic cylinder extends downwardly and by the top Pressure disk 53 pushes down on, and the press disk 53, which is moved downward, to abut with left 32 top end face of elevator and by the left liter Drop block 32 pushes down on, and the left elevator 32 pushes down on the elastic force for overcoming the left top pressure spring 35 and by the cutting Knife 38 is pushed to the medicinal material and contains in chamber 23, until the left elevator 32 pushes down on and 22 top of medicinal material Article holding box Face abuts and covers medicinal material splendid attire chamber 23, finally controls the left driving motor 393 and works, the left driving motor 393 work rotations make first left rotation shaft under the engaged transmission of first left gear 39 and the second left gear 391 37 rotate and three cutter 38 are driven to rotate, so that containing the medicinal material in chamber 23 to the medicinal material carries out chopping operation, In cutting process, medicinal material will not drop out the medicinal material and contain chamber 23, after medicinal material cutting is completed, first control the left driving electricity Machine 393 stops working, then controls the hydraulic cylinder 51 and work so that the press disk 53 is retracted into the disk cavity 50, And the left elevator 32 then upward sliding and drives the cutter 38 under the resilient force of the left top pressure spring 35 It exits the medicinal material to contain in chamber 23, the work of first motor 64 reversion is finally controlled, to drive the chopping component extensive Initial position is arrived again,
Need to shred later medicinal material be stirred with other medicines mix when, first the mixed other medicines of needs are added Enter to medicinal material and contain in chamber 23, controls second motor 63 later and work, moved described in 63 task driven of the second motor Block 61 slides into the right the right end position of the shifting chute 60, and the drive bevel gear 65 is nibbled with the right bevel gear 68 at this time It closes, controls the first motor 64 later and work, drive bevel gear 65 described in 64 task driven of first motor rotates, described Right bevel gear 68 described in 65 rotate driving of drive bevel gear rotates, and the right rotation of bevel gear 68 drives described 69 turns of right-hand thread bar Dynamic, right sliding shoe 40 described in 69 rotate driving of right-hand thread bar slides to the left, and the right sliding shoe 40 slides to the left drives institute It states right elevator 42 to slide and be inserted into the processing of crude drugs chamber 2 to the left, until the right sliding shoe 40 slides into institute to the left The left end position of right sliding groove 4 is stated, the stirring rod 48 is located at the top that the medicinal material contains chamber 23 at this time, then controls institute State the work of hydraulic cylinder 51, hydraulic telescopic rod 52 described in 51 task driven of hydraulic cylinder extends downwardly and by the press disk 53 Push down on, the press disk 53 move downward abutted with right 42 top end face of elevator and by the right elevator 42 to Lower promotion, the right elevator 42 push down on the elastic force for overcoming the right top pressure spring 45 and push the stirring rod 48 It contains in chamber 23 to the medicinal material, is abutted simultaneously until the right elevator 42 is pushed down on 22 top end face of medicinal material Article holding box Medicinal material splendid attire chamber 23 is covered, the right driving motor 493 is finally controlled and works, the work of right driving motor 493 turns It moves and makes the rotation of the first right rotation shafts 47 and band under the engaged transmission of first right gear 49 and the second right gear 491 Dynamic three stirring rod 48 rotate, thus to the medicinal material contain the medicinal material shredded in chamber 23 be stirred with other medicines it is mixed Cooperate industry, during being stirred, the medicinal material of chopping will not drop out the medicinal material and contain chamber 23, be stirred complete with Afterwards, it first controls the right driving motor 493 to stop working, then controls the hydraulic cylinder 51 and work so that the press disk 53 contracts It returns in the disk cavity 50, and the right elevator 42 then slides up under the resilient force of the right top pressure spring 45 It moves and the stirring rod 48 is driven to exit the medicinal material and contain in chamber 23, finally control the work of first motor 64 reversion, from And the mixing component is driven to be restored to initial position, finally, to remove the medicinal material Article holding box 22, and by working process The medicinal material of completion carries out the processing of other process.
